Compliance program framework
The QUT compliance program was established by University Council in 2002 to administer and manage the University's statutory obligations. The program is based on the Australian Standard AS3806-2006 Compliance Programs which provides a best practice guide for compliance programs in Australia.
The compliance program forms an integral part of the University's Governance Framework by articulating and delivering QUT's commitment to robust compliance processes.
The compliance program framework encompasses the following elements:
- the Compliance Policy (MOPP A/1.3), authorised by Council;
- the Register of Compliance Obligations, providing a comprehensive list of QUT's statutory obligations and compliance procedures;
- designation of responsible officers for specific obligations;
- annual identification and rating of risks related to compliance;
- annual reporting by responsible officers on non-compliance incidents and compliance issues;
- reporting on major non-compliance incidents and compliance trends to the University's Audit and Risk Management Committee; and
- advice and information provided by the policy and compliance unit in Governance Services.
Register of Compliance Obligations
The Register of Compliance Obligations is a comprehensive list of QUT's statutory obligations. It designates officers' responsibility for compliance and details the procedures taken by organisational areas to ensure compliance. The Register is continually updated as required.
The Register is available for viewing by responsible officer or classification of obligation.

Administration of the program
The Registrar is responsible for the compliance program. The Policy and Compliance Manager in Governance Services is responsible for administering the program.
